
次のコマンドを使用して、Slackware にインストールする php7 パッケージをダウンロードしようとしました。
wget "http://php.net/get/php-7.1.3.tar.gz/from/a/mirror"
結果はmirror
ファイルです、もう一度作るとしたらmirror.1
...
このファイルで installpkg を実行するにはどうすればいいでしょうか?
答え1
これは正常です。wget は最後のパス コンポーネントをファイル名として使用するだけです。
--trust-server-names
を使用すると、サーバーが提案するファイル名(Web ブラウザーのように)を使用するか、自分でファイル名を指定することができます-O php-7.1.3.tar.gz
。
ただし、ここではURLが間違っています。http://php.net/get/php-7.1.3.tar.gz
と はどちらもhttp://php.net/get/php-7.1.3.tar.gz/from/a/mirror
HTMLウェブページにつながるだけです。そのページにアクセスしてください。ウェブブラウザで特定のダウンロード URL を選択します。例:
wget --trust-server-names http://dk2.php.net/get/php-7.1.3.tar.gz/from/this/mirror